Text to speech AI: Czym jest i jak działa technologia TTS?

Spis treści

Technologia Text to Speech AI (TTS) to zaawansowane rozwiązanie oparte na sztucznej inteligencji, które przekształca tekst pisany w naturalnie brzmiącą mowę ludzką. Dzięki wykorzystaniu algorytmów uczenia maszynowego i przetwarzania języka naturalnego (NLP), systemy TTS potrafią generować głos, który jest często trudny do odróżnienia od prawdziwego człowieka, uwzględniając intonację, emocje i akcenty.

Czym jest technologia text to speech AI?

Technologia text to speech AI to proces, w którym oprogramowanie komputerowe odczytuje na głos tekst cyfrowy, wykorzystując do tego zaawansowane sieci neuronowe. Systemy te nie tylko konwertują litery na dźwięki, ale analizują całe zdania, aby nadać wypowiedzi odpowiedni kontekst, rytm i melodię, co czyni mowę bardziej naturalną i zrozumiałą dla słuchacza.

Jak działa syntezator mowy oparty na AI?

Syntezator mowy oparty na AI działa w dwuetapowym procesie: najpierw analizuje lingwistycznie tekst wejściowy, a następnie generuje na jego podstawie falę dźwiękową. Ten zintegrowany proces pozwala na tworzenie płynnej i spójnej mowy, która naśladuje subtelne niuanse ludzkiego głosu, takie jak pauzy czy zmiany tonu w zależności od znaczenia zdania.

  1. Analiza tekstu (front-end): Algorytmy przetwarzania języka naturalnego (NLP) przetwarzają surowy tekst, normalizując go i przekształcając w reprezentację fonetyczną. Na tym etapie identyfikowane są słowa, zdania, interpunkcja oraz określana jest intonacja i akcentowanie.
  2. Synteza dźwięku (back-end): Na podstawie przetworzonych danych lingwistycznych, głębokie sieci neuronowe, takie jak WaveNet czy Tacotron 2, generują surową falę dźwiękową, która jest następnie przetwarzana, aby uzyskać finalny, czysty dźwięk mowy.

Na czym polega analiza tekstu przez algorytmy?

Analiza tekstu przez algorytmy polega na dogłębnym zrozumieniu jego struktury gramatycznej, semantycznej i kontekstowej w celu zaplanowania sposobu wypowiedzi. System identyfikuje części mowy, granice zdań i fraz oraz znaki interpunkcyjne, aby precyzyjnie określić, gdzie należy zastosować pauzy, jaki akcent nadać słowom i jaką intonację przyjąć dla całego zdania (np. pytającą lub oznajmującą).

Jak sieci neuronowe generują naturalną mowę?

Sieci neuronowe generują naturalną mowę poprzez syntezę fali dźwiękowej próbka po próbce, naśladując złożone wzorce ludzkiego głosu, których nauczyły się na ogromnych zbiorach danych audio. Modele te potrafią nie tylko odtworzyć brzmienie głosu, ale również uchwycić jego unikalne cechy, takie jak tempo, ton i emocje, co prowadzi do syntezy mowy o wysokim stopniu naturalności.

Jakie są kluczowe zalety technologii text to speech?

Kluczowe zalety technologii text to speech to przede wszystkim zwiększona dostępność cyfrowa, możliwość personalizacji głosu, wysoka efektywność dzięki automatyzacji oraz globalny zasięg dzięki obsłudze wielu języków. Technologie te otwierają nowe możliwości w komunikacji, edukacji i obsłudze klienta, czyniąc treści bardziej angażującymi i łatwiejszymi do przyswojenia dla szerokiego grona odbiorców.

Wsparcie dostępności i inkluzywności dla użytkowników

Wsparcie dostępności i inkluzywności polega na ułatwianiu dostępu do treści cyfrowych osobom z dysfunkcjami wzroku, trudnościami w czytaniu (np. dysleksją) oraz seniorom. Dzięki TTS strony internetowe, książki i dokumenty stają się dostępne dla każdego, kto nie może lub nie chce czytać tekstu, co promuje równość w dostępie do informacji.

Personalizacja głosu i naturalne brzmienie mowy

Personalizacja głosu i naturalne brzmienie mowy są możliwe dzięki zdolności systemów AI do modulowania tonu, tempa oraz emocji, co sprawia, że wygenerowany głos jest bardziej angażujący. Firmy mogą tworzyć unikalne głosy dla swoich marek, które wzmacniają ich tożsamość i budują lepsze relacje z klientami poprzez spersonalizowaną komunikację głosową.

Automatyzacja zadań i większa efektywność

Automatyzacja zadań i większa efektywność to korzyści wynikające ze zdolności systemów TTS do samodzielnego i natychmiastowego generowania komunikatów głosowych bez udziału człowieka. Jest to kluczowe w systemach powiadomień, nawigacjach GPS czy w centrach obsługi klienta, gdzie pozwala na obsługę tysięcy zapytań jednocześnie, 24/7.

Obsługa wielu języków i globalne zastosowania

Obsługa wielu języków i dialektów pozwala na globalne skalowanie aplikacji i usług, docierając do użytkowników na całym świecie w ich ojczystym języku. Dla międzynarodowych firm jest to nieocenione narzędzie do lokalizowania produktów, materiałów marketingowych i wsparcia klienta, zapewniając spójne doświadczenie niezależnie od regionu.

Wybierając dostawcę technologii TTS, zwróć uwagę nie tylko na naturalność brzmienia, ale także na dostępność API, łatwość integracji oraz model cenowy. Niektóre platformy oferują zaawansowane opcje personalizacji głosu (np. klonowanie), co może być kluczowe dla budowania unikalnej tożsamości głosowej Twojej marki.

Gdzie wykorzystuje się syntezę mowy AI?

Synteza mowy AI jest wykorzystywana w wielu sektorach, w tym w edukacji do tworzenia materiałów e-learningowych, w obsłudze klienta do automatyzacji komunikacji, w mediach do produkcji treści audio oraz jako technologia asystująca dla osób z niepełnosprawnościami. Jej wszechstronność sprawia, że staje się standardem w nowoczesnych aplikacjach i urządzeniach cyfrowych.

Przykłady zastosowań technologii Text to Speech AI w różnych sektorach
Sektor Konkretne zastosowanie Główna korzyść
Edukacja i e-learning Audiobooki, interaktywne kursy, nauka języków Wsparcie różnych stylów uczenia się i dostępność
Obsługa klienta Systemy IVR, wirtualni asystenci, chatboty głosowe Automatyzacja, redukcja kosztów, dostępność 24/7
Media i rozrywka Podcasty, dubbing filmów, głosy postaci w grach Szybka produkcja treści i redukcja kosztów
Dostępność Czytniki ekranu, aplikacje dla osób niewidomych Równy dostęp do informacji i samodzielność
Transport i nawigacja Komunikaty głosowe w nawigacjach GPS i pojazdach Bezpieczeństwo i wygoda kierowcy

Zastosowanie TTS w edukacji i e-learningu

W edukacji i e-learningu technologia TTS jest używana do tworzenia audiobooków, interaktywnych materiałów kursowych oraz narzędzi wspierających naukę wymowy w językach obcych. Umożliwia to uczniom przyswajanie wiedzy poprzez słuchanie, co jest szczególnie pomocne dla audialnych stylów uczenia się oraz dla osób z dysleksją.

Wykorzystanie w obsłudze klienta i systemach IVR

W obsłudze klienta TTS wykorzystuje się do zasilania automatycznych systemów IVR (Interactive Voice Response), chatbotów głosowych i wirtualnych asystentów. Dzięki temu firmy mogą szybko i efektywnie odpowiadać na standardowe zapytania klientów, skracając czas oczekiwania na połączenie i optymalizując pracę konsultantów.

Technologia TTS jako wsparcie dla osób z niepełnosprawnościami

Jako wsparcie dla osób z niepełnosprawnościami, technologia TTS umożliwia osobom niewidomym i niedowidzącym dostęp do treści pisanych, takich jak strony internetowe, e-maile czy książki, poprzez ich odsłuchanie. Czytniki ekranu (screen readers) wykorzystujące TTS są kluczowym narzędziem zapewniającym cyfrową niezależność.

Synteza mowy w mediach, grach i rozrywce

W mediach, grach i rozrywce synteza mowy służy do szybkiej produkcji podcastów, generowania głosów dla postaci niezależnych (NPC) w grach wideo oraz tworzenia wersji audio artykułów. Pozwala to twórcom na znaczne obniżenie kosztów i skrócenie czasu produkcji w porównaniu z zatrudnianiem profesjonalnych lektorów do każdego zadania.

Implementując TTS w grach lub aplikacjach multimedialnych, rozważ użycie SSML (Speech Synthesis Markup Language). Ten język znaczników pozwala na precyzyjną kontrolę nad generowaną mową, umożliwiając dostosowanie tempa, głośności, tonu, a nawet dodawanie pauz czy specyficznej wymowy dla poszczególnych słów, co znacznie podnosi jakość finalnego dźwięku.

Najczęściej zadawane pytania (FAQ)

Jaka jest różnica między TTS a technologią rozpoznawania mowy (ASR)?

Technologia TTS (Text to Speech) przekształca tekst w mowę, podczas gdy ASR (Automatic Speech Recognition), znana też jako speech-to-text, działa w przeciwnym kierunku – konwertuje mowę na tekst. TTS „mówi”, a ASR „słucha” i „rozumie”.

Czy mogę stworzyć klon własnego głosu za pomocą TTS?

Tak, niektóre zaawansowane platformy TTS oferują usługę klonowania głosu (voice cloning). Proces ten wymaga dostarczenia próbek nagrań głosu, na podstawie których model AI uczy się jego unikalnych cech, a następnie może generować mowę w tym głosie na podstawie dowolnego tekstu.

Ile kosztuje wdrożenie technologii TTS w aplikacji?

Koszt zależy od dostawcy i modelu rozliczeniowego. Większość platform, jak Google Cloud Text-to-Speech czy Amazon Polly, oferuje model pay-as-you-go, gdzie płaci się za liczbę przetworzonych znaków. Często dostępne są darmowe pakiety startowe na określoną liczbę znaków miesięcznie.

Jakie są główne wyzwania etyczne związane z syntezą mowy AI?

Główne wyzwania etyczne to ryzyko tworzenia deepfake’ów audio, czyli fałszywych nagrań głosu konkretnych osób w celu dezinformacji lub oszustwa. Inne obawy dotyczą praw autorskich do sklonowanych głosów oraz potencjalnego zastępowania ludzkich lektorów i aktorów głosowych.

Czy jakość mowy generowanej przez AI jest już na poziomie profesjonalnego lektora?

Najlepsze systemy TTS osiągają niezwykle wysoki poziom naturalności, często trudny do odróżnienia od ludzkiej mowy w neutralnych wypowiedziach. Jednak profesjonalni lektorzy wciąż mają przewagę w zakresie przekazywania złożonych emocji, subtelnej interpretacji artystycznej i unikalnego stylu, które są trudne do pełnego zreplikowania przez AI.

Jakie języki programowania są najczęściej używane do integracji z API TTS?

Do integracji z API TTS najczęściej wykorzystuje się popularne języki programowania, takie jak Python, JavaScript (Node.js), Java, C# oraz PHP. Większość dostawców usług TTS oferuje gotowe biblioteki klienckie (SDK) dla tych języków, co znacznie upraszcza proces implementacji.

Źródła:
https://simple.wikipedia.org/wiki/Text_to_speech

Rozwijaj swoją markę! Dzięki współpracy ze mną!